Martini & Sohn “Pure Origin” Vernatsch is a refined, high-altitude expression of 100% Schiava, a noble and historic grape native to Alto Adige. Crafted in the acclaimed hillside zones of Cornaiano and Colterenzio, this wine represents the purest form of Vernatsch: graceful, perfumed, delicately coloured and remarkably complex.

In the glass, it shows a luminous pale-to-medium ruby red, capturing the elegance and transparency that define top-quality Schiava. The nose is beautifully lifted and aromatic — wild cherries, raspberry, violet petals and gentle almond, a hallmark of the grape. Every swirl adds more nuance: soft red berries, subtle spice, and the clean mountain freshness that only Alto Adige can deliver.

The palate is silky, refined and exceptionally balanced. Tannins are naturally fine and smooth, allowing the purity of the fruit to shine without heaviness. Expect fresh red cherry, raspberry coulis and floral notes wrapped in a delicate almond-like finish. Despite its elegance, the wine carries a quiet concentration — a testament to meticulous vineyard work and low yields of 75 hl/ha.

The vineyards, trained under the traditional Pergola system, sit on mineral-rich soils shaped by centuries of Alpine and volcanic activity. Cool mountain breezes and significant day–night temperature shifts help the grapes develop perfume, precision and freshness.

Winemaking is deliberately gentle: malolactic fermentation in stainless steel preserves purity, while maturation in large 15hl oak casks adds finesse, roundness and textural harmony without masking the fruit. This is Vernatsch in its most authentic, premium form.

Drink now for its vibrant fruit or cellar for 1–5 years to enjoy evolving complexity.
